About the Role

We are recruiting on behalf of a public sector client for two Museum Assistants - Facilities & Environment to support operations at a busy and well-established museum site.

This is a varied and hands-on role combining facilities support, visitor services, security, and event delivery within a heritage setting.

Key Responsibilities

  • Carry out daily building and safety checks, including fire alarms, emergency lighting, and maintenance reporting
  • Maintain security and public safety across the museum, including galleries and external areas
  • Undertake cleaning and housekeeping duties to a high standard
  • Provide front-of-house support, including reception, shop duties, and cash handling
  • Assist with event setup and delivery, including room layouts and AV equipment
  • Deliver guided tours and visitor experiences where required
  • Support exhibition work, collections care, and general museum tasks
  • Monitor systems such as CCTV, alarms, and building services
  • Assist with contractor supervision and ensure health & safety compliance
  • Carry out Fire Warden duties and support emergency procedures
  • Contribute to educational activities and public events
